A KEIGHLEY firm is celebrating the success of two audits in recent weeks.
The heat treatment division at Keighley Laboratories Limited has achieved the Nadcap (heat treating) accreditation for its Nitriding process, adding to the firm’s growing list of accreditations and prime approvals.
This achievement demonstrates the firm’s commitment to delivering the highest standards of heat treating to the aerospace industry.
“Congratulations to Keighley Laboratories on successfully passing what may be the aerospace industry’s most stringent process capability assessment audit,” said Joe Pinto, executive vice president and chief operating officer at the Performance Review Institute.
“Nadcap audit criteria are widely acknowledged to be hard to meet and companies like Keighley Labs, who succeed at doing so, rightfully deserve recognition.”
In addition, the heat treatment division has recently undergone a successful annual BSI reassessment.
Managing director, Debbie Mellor said: “The range and number of accreditations held by Keighley Laboratories builds the support and confidence of our customers.
“They highlight the company’s achievements and strengths, particularly important in our competitive market.”
